Types of Childcare Options

There are several forms of childcare options available, each catering to different age brackets and schedules. Probably the most common types of childcare options consist of:

  1. Daycare facilities: Daycare facilities tend to be facilities that provide take care of kids of numerous centuries, usually from infancy to preschool. These centers are certified and managed by the condition, making certain they meet specific requirements for protection, cleanliness, and staff skills. Daycare centers offer structured activities, dishes, and direction for children in friends setting.

  1. Family Child Care Homes: Family childcare houses tend to be tiny, home-based child care facilities run by a single caregiver or a tiny band of caregivers. These providers provide a more individualized and family-like environment for children, with a lot fewer children in attention versus daycare facilities. Family childcare homes can offer flexible hours and rates, making all of them a popular choice for moms and dads who require more personalized maintain their child.

  1. Preschools: Preschools are educational organizations that provide early childhood training for kids usually between your many years of 2 to 5 years old. These programs focus on planning kids for kindergarten Daycares By Category presenting them to fundamental academic ideas, personal abilities, and emotional development. Preschools often are powered by a school-year schedule and gives part-time or full-time choices for parents.

  1. Pre and post class Programs: pre and post college programs are created to offer care for school-aged young ones during the hours before and after the standard school day. These programs provide many different tasks, research help, and guidance for the kids while parents are in work. Before and after college programs are usually provided by schools, community facilities, or private businesses.

  1. Nanny or Au set: Nannies and au pairs tend to be individuals who provide in-home childcare services for families. Nannies are often skilled professionals who offer full-time care for kiddies when you look at the family members' home, while au sets are teenagers from foreign countries whom live with the family and offer social exchange alongside childcare. Nannies and au sets offer personalized care and flexibility in scheduling for moms and dads.

Things to consider Whenever Choosing Childcare

Whenever choosing childcare in your area, it is critical to give consideration to a number of elements to ensure you discover an excellent and suitable option for your child. A few of the key factors to take into account include:

  1. Licensing and Accreditation: it is vital to choose an authorized and approved child care supplier, as this ensures that the center satisfies particular requirements for safety, cleanliness, staff skills, and system high quality. Certification and accreditation indicate that provider has withstood a rigorous evaluation procedure and is invested in maintaining high standards of attention.

  1. Staff Qualifications and Training: The qualifications and instruction of staff in the child care center are crucial in providing high quality look after young ones. Seek out providers with trained and skilled caregivers, as well as staff who're certified in CPR and medical. Staff-to-child ratios are also crucial, as they determine the level of attention and guidance that every son or daughter gets.

  1. Curriculum and plan strategies: Consider the curriculum and program tasks made available from the child treatment provider, while they perform an important part in the development and learning of one's son or daughter. Seek programs offering age-appropriate activities, academic opportunities, and opportunities for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um that features play, art, songs, and outside time can donate to your kid's overall development.

  1. Safety and health Policies: Ensure that the little one attention supplier has strict health and safety guidelines in position to guard the well being of the kid. Search for services that follow appropriate health techniques, have protected entry and exit treatments, and keep maintaining a clear and child-friendly environment. Ask about emergency treatments, infection policies, and just how the supplier manages accidents or incidents.

  1. Parent Involvement and correspondence: Pick a kid attention provider that encourages moms and dad involvement and keeps available interaction with people. Choose providers that provide options for parents to participate in tasks, occasions, and conferences, including regular changes on the kid's progress and well being. A stronger relationship between parents and caregivers can result in an optimistic and supportive child care knowledge.

Finding Childcare Near You

Now you have considered the facets to look for in a young child care provider, it is the right time to start the research quality childcare near you. Below are a few ideas and sources to help you find the best option for your youngster:

  1. Require suggestions: Start by requesting suggestions from family, pals, neighbors, and colleagues who possess children in childcare. Individual referrals could be an invaluable way to obtain information on high quality childcare providers in your town. Ask about their experiences, what they fancy about the supplier, and any concerns they might have.

  1. Analysis on line: Use online resources such as for instance childcare directories, parenting internet sites, and social media marketing groups to research child care providers in your town. Look for providers with positive reviews, high reviews, and step-by-step information on their particular programs and services. Many providers have actually web sites or social networking pages where you could learn more about their services and staff.

  1. Browse Child Care Centers: Schedule visits to potential childcare centers to tour the services, meet the staff, and take notice of the system for action. Pay attention to the hygiene, security precautions, and overall environment of this center. Inquire about the curriculum, staff skills, day-to-day routines, and guidelines getting a sense of how the center works.

  1. Interview Caregivers: whenever ending up in possible caregivers, enquire about their particular experience, training, and approach to childcare. Inquire about their particular philosophy on control, communication with parents, and how they handle emergencies or difficult actions. Trust your instincts and select caregivers that warm, attentive, and responsive to your child's requirements.

  1. Examine References: Request references through the childcare supplier and contact all of them to check out their experiences utilizing the supplier. Inquire about the caliber of attention, interaction with parents, staff interactions, and any problems they may have experienced. Sources can offer important ideas into the provider's reputation and background.

  1. Start thinking about Cost and Convenience: consider the cost of child care and just how it suits into the spending plan, as well as the ease of the place and hours of operation. Compare rates, fees, and repayment choices among different providers to discover the best worth for your needs. Start thinking about facets such as transportation, distance to your house or work, and versatility in scheduling.
